Job Description

The Sr. Dispatcher serves as a subject matter expert within Cox Fleet's dispatch operations, responsible for managing the full lifecycle of fleet repairs and maintenance. This national role operates within multiple markets across the country and requires a high degree of professional judgment, industry knowledge, and the ability to coordinate effectively across internal partners, customers, and third-party vendors. The Sr. Dispatcher is expected to model best practices, support less experienced team members, and uphold Cox Fleet's standards for service quality and customer experience.

Essential Responsibilities

Service Coordination and Dispatch

  • Manage the complete event lifecycle for preventative maintenance, towing, and unscheduled/emergency service events, from initial client request to repair-completion
  • Ensure that technicians receive all service events quickly, and request additional work when needed
  • Re-assign previous events that were not completed during the first assignment
  • Assess each service event and dispatch to achieve the best results for the client
  • Assign work with an eye toward time-based KPIs
  • Identify gaps in KPI performance, and work with local leaders to address those gaps
  • Audit open work requests across multiple markets for compliance with daily-update requirements
  • Monitor open events, track estimated arrival times, and communicate proactively with customers and leadership regarding delays or service concerns

Customer and Stakeholder Communication

  • Communicate with all parties to ensure work is prioritized and completed, and that all parties remain fully informed on status along the way. Clients should always be able to self-serve complete and up-to-date information on service events.
  • Obtain estimates and estimate approvals
  • Serve as a point of contact for escalated service issues from customers, team members, and internal stakeholders, addressing concerns with professionalism and urgency
  • Maintain positive customer relationships through clear, timely, and professional communication across all channels
  • Apply sound judgment and diplomacy when navigating competing priorities or complex service situations across multiple markets and personalities
  • Collaborate with internal partners to resolve multi-party service issues and ensure customer needs are met within established timelines

Vendor Management

  • Ensure all third-party vendors are informed of and operate in accordance with Cox Fleet policies, procedures, and expectations for quality, timeliness, and payment
  • Monitor vendor performance and document issues; escalate systemic concerns through established channels

Documentation and Compliance

  • Maintain timely and accurate documentation and notations in all applicable systems for each customer interaction and service event
  • Follow established escalation procedures for complex or high-risk service situations
  • Adhere to all applicable company policies, internal controls, and compliance requirements

Team Contribution and Development

  • Provide process guidance and on-the-job coaching for less experienced dispatch team members
  • Keep open-event backlogs clean with proper process adherence
  • Contribute to the continuous improvement of dispatching practices, workflows, and service quality standards
  • Demonstrate consistent professionalism and customer-focused behavior as a senior member of the dispatch team
  • Perform additional duties as assigned by the Dispatch Supervisor or leadership
